BlindWrite is an open-source word processor and screen reader designed for visually impaired users. It includes text-to-speech capabilities and keyboard shortcuts to make typing and editing documents more accessible.
Format Factory is a free multimedia file converter for Windows. It supports converting between audio, video, and image formats like MP3, MP4, JPG in batches. It's lightweight, easy to use, and fast.
